For the last few weeks, I've gotten really interested in making a Portable Wii, and after a bit of time, I have accumulated to what I think is all of the parts and tools that I would need for a Portable Wii, including the boards from 4LayerTech and the Custom PCBs.

I have decided to go for a Louii (Designed by GingerOfOz) because I really like the form factor of it. I know that the Ashida is recommended for beginners but I don't really like the bulkiness of it. This Louii will feature a purple case (printed by @Customledmods) and white buttons. Instead of having to sacrifice a Wii (or multiple), I instead bought the trimmed Wii from @CrazyGadget

Since the triggers were 3D printed, they were a pretty tight fit onto the case. This unfortunately led to me trying for a few hours to try and get it to fit into the case, but the Left Trigger just started to stop screwing into the case, so until I could afford to get a new trigger or until I could buy my own 3D printer, this project will have to be put onto hold.
